Good morning all. I have been doing some searching and find myself even more confused by contradictory theory/advice. My question is this, I have a Sansui G5000 receiver which has a sticker on the back stating to use speakers with an 8 ohm load. Is it possible to use speakers with a 4 ohm load with this receiver without jeopardizing and subjecting the unit to undue stress? I understand that it may run hotter? with the 4 ohm, but will it shorten the life of the receiver? Thanks in advance for your knowledge. J.

a sticker on the back stating to use speakers with an 8 ohm load.

Doesn't it actually say something like "use 8 ohm speakers when connecting 2 pairs of speakers"? My G9000 says that. That alone would mean the receiver is okay with a single pair of 4 ohm ones.

What I believe...there are some 4 ohm speakers that are easier to drive than some 8 ohm ones. The nominal rating a manufacturer gives his speaker is "his" average of what the impedance is across the musical spectrum from the lowest amount to the highest. If that range varies a lot, the speaker will be a tougher load regardless if it's 4 ohms or 8 ohms.

There is a "sticky" here on how 4 ohm loads stress an amp or receiver if you want more info but yes, a good 4 ohm load will stress an amp more than a good 8 ohm one. If your don't play your music at window rattling levels I think your Sansui is built well enough to handle it (one pair that is).

The back panel says, "When you connect two pairs of speaker systems, each of them must have impedance of 8 ohms or more."


The service manual shows A + B speaker selection is parallel.

By this, the unit itself indicates 4 ohms is acceptable. However, if a pair is 4 ohms then NO other speakers can be used (turned on) simultaneously as that will result in less than 4 ohms.
